Apple iTunes up to 12.6.1 on Windows WebKit Web Inspector memory corruption

Summary
A vulnerability categorized as critical has been discovered in Apple iTunes up to 12.6.1 on Windows. The affected element is an unknown function of the component WebKit Web Inspector. Executing a manipulation can lead to memory corruption. This vulnerability appears as CVE-2017-7012. The attack may be performed from remote. There is no available exploit. It is advisable to upgrade the affected component.
Details
A vulnerability was found in Apple iTunes up to 12.6.1 on Windows (Multimedia Player Software). It has been declared as critical. This vulnerability affects an unknown functionality of the component WebKit Web Inspector.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a memory corruption v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-119. The product performs operations on a memory buffer, but it can read from or write to a memory location that is outside of the intended boundary of the buffer.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ability.
The bug was discovered 07/19/2017. The weakness was presented 07/19/2017 by lokihardt with Apple as HT207928 as confirmed advisory (Website). The advisory is shared for download at support.apple.com. This vulnerability was named CVE-2017-7012 since 03/17/2017. The attack can be initiated remotely. No form of authentication is required for a successful exploitation. Successful exploitation requires user interaction by the victim. There are neither technical details nor an exploit publicly available. The advisory points out:
Multiple memory corruption issues were addressed with improved memory handling.
The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 101966 (FreeBSD : webkit2-gtk3 -- multiple vulnerabilities (0f66b901-715c-11e7-ad1f-bcaec565249c)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family FreeBSD Local Security Checks and running in the context l.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 370477 (Apple iTunes Prior to 12.6.2 Multiple Memory Currption Vulnerabilities. (APPLE-SA-2017-07-19-6)).
Upgrading to version 12.6.2 eliminates this vulnerability. A possible mitigation has been published immediately after the disclosure of the vulnerability.
